Hardship Alert: Shehu Sani Advises Senate President Akpabio to Avoid Wuse 2 Amid Protests
In a recent post on his X handle, former lawmaker Shehu Sani has cautioned Senate President Godswill Akpabio against passing through Wuse 2 in Abuja due to ongoing protests. Sani recounted his own encounter with demonstrators in the area, who were rallying against widespread hunger in the country.
According to Sani, while the protesters recognized him and allowed him to proceed, he expressed doubts that Akpabio would receive the same treatment. He urged the Senate President to steer clear of the area to avoid potential confrontation.
“I just passed a group of protesters in Wuse 2, carrying placards against ‘hunger in the land’. Some ladies among them recognized me and shouted ‘No be that Afro Senator be that.’ I answered, ‘Yes, na me, the former Senator,’ and they responded, ‘Oya pass.’ Make Akpabio no pass there o,” Sani wrote.
